How did your business get started?
I started Oxmantown Skincare while working as a Holistic Therapist. I was treating clients with many different skin concerns and issues. I had just completed my studies in Aromatherapy and I was blending oils from my kitchen table. the demand for my botanical oils grew as did the product range.
Over the years I had travelled to India many times which sparked my interest and learning in Ayurveda, I came to the conclusion that products didn't need to be full of chemicals, but instead I could harness the power of nature using herbs and different parts of plants to heal the skin. And so Oxmantown Skincare was born.
 
What is behind the brand name and how did you come up with it?
 
The name Oxmantown comes from the area where the Vikings settled in Dublin, Stoneybatter. It's also where the products are made so I wanted the name and brand to reflect that. We're very proud of being a Dublin based skincare company.

What do you find the hardest running your own business?
 
The hardest thing is being disciplined, being your own boss you have plenty of time to procrastinate. I also find not having a team around me to bounce ideas off to be quite difficult. Working by yourself can be quite isolating sometimes.

Do you have any advice for anyone thinking of taking the plunge and starting a business?
 
I think the most important things when starting a business is to make sure it's something you are really passionate about. Do your market research, find your target market and from there see how you are going to sell to them e.g are you going to sell online, wholesale or both and make sure your pricing covers such factors. If you have the idea, are willing to pursue it and put in the  hard work then just go for it!
